Game of Thrones spinoff House of the Dragon launches on HBO in 2022 and today’s new trailer is dominated by the face and voice of former Doctor Who star Matt Smith.

Set 200 years before the events of Game of Thrones, Smith plays Daemon Targaryen, one of the dragon-affiliated, interbreeding princes of legend in George RR Martin’s Fire & Blood. Younger brother of king Viserys I (Paddy Considine), Daemon appears to be a key character in the forthcoming series.

Meanwhile, Emma D’Arcy plays Princess Rhaenyra Targaryen, and Rhys Ifans as Otto Hightower, is the Hand of the King. Rivals to House Targaryen, House Velaryon is just as old and features Steve Toussaint as Lord Corlys Velaryon (aka “The Sea Snake”) and Eve Best as Princess Rhaenys Velaryon.

Also cast is Jefferson Hall as twins Lord Jason Lannister and Tyland Lannister, with veteran actors Bill Paterson (Lord Lyman Beesbury), Graham McTavish (Ser Harrold Westerling), and David Horovitch (Grand Maester Mellos).

Expect power struggles, dragons, and far less nudity and mysogyny than Game of Thrones when House of the Dragon hits streaming services in 2022.
